FLOWERY BRANCH — The Falcons are between $7.8 million to $8.1 million under the NFL salary cap, according to several sources.

According to the NFLPA’s public salary cap report (Top 51), the Falcons have 62 players under contract, $3,905,771 in previous year carryover, $150,629,528 in team cap and are $8,172,143 under the cap.

The Falcons are $7,869,064 million under the cap and have $18,814,246 in dead money on their cap charge, according to overthecap.com.

The Falcons have $7,868,897 in cap space, according to spotrac.com.
